ÂÜÀòÂÒÂ×

Doug Bewsher

Advisor at Demand Spring

No bio yet


Org chart

This person is not in the org chart



Offices

This person is not in any offices


Demand Spring

1 followers

Demand Spring is an integrated Revenue Marketing consultancy that helps marketing organizations stand taller by enabling them to scale their ability to contribute to pipeline and revenue.


Industries

Headquarters

Ottawa, Canada

Employees

11-50

Links

Ad

Ad